Allgemeines, Mailingliste
Allg., Mailingliste
KEYTAB für Anwender
KEYTAB - Anwender
KEYTAB für Entwickler
KEYTAB - Entwickler
KEYTAB und der Euro
KEYTAB und der Euro
Installation
Installation
Die Zeichensätze
Die Zeichensätze
Download
Download
History
History
Die KEYTAB-Bibliothek
KEYTAB - Bibliothek
Home Die KEYTAB-Bibliothek Akt_StringAtari2X Akt_StringX2Unicode
   KEYTAB
 Die KEYTAB-Bibliothek

Akt_StringX2Atari

Kurzbeschreibung: Einen (C-)String aus einem 8-Bit-Zeichensatz in den Atari-Zeichensatz wandeln
 
C: char *Akt_StringX2Atari( char *dest_string,
         short nr, char *source_string );
 
Pascal: Function Akt_StringX2Atari(
               dest_string: PChar; nr: Integer;
               source_string: PChar
            ) : PChar;
 
GFA: FUNCTION kt_string.x2atari(des%,nr&,src%)
 

Die Funktion Akt_StringX2Atari konvertiert den (C-)String source_string aus dem angegebenen Zeichensatz in den Atari-Zeichensatz und legt ihn in dest_string ab. Die beiden Speicherbereiche dest_string und source_string können identisch ein.

Ein Zeiger auf den Ziel-String wird zurückgegeben.

Falls KEYTAB nicht installiert ist, ein Fehler auftritt oder ein nicht vorhandener Import-Zeichensatz verwendet werden soll, wird nichts gewandelt.

Hinweis: Akt_StringX2Atari(dest, nr, source) wird intern auf Akt_BlockX2Atari(dest, nr, source, strlen(source)+1) abgebildet.


Copyright © Martin Elsässer (eMail-Adressen)
Letzte Aktualisierung am 12. Dezember 2006
Home Die KEYTAB-Bibliothek Akt_StringAtari2X Akt_StringX2Unicode